From Webster's Revised Unabridged Dictionary (1913) (web1913)
Bastardize \Bas"tard*ize\, v. t. [imp. & p. p. {Bastardized}
(?); p. pr. & vb. n. {Bastardizing}.]
1. To make or prove to be a bastard; to stigmatize as a
bastard; to declare or decide legally to be illegitimate.
The law is so indulgent as not to bastardize the
child, if born, though not begotten, in lawful
wedlock. --Blackstone.
2. To beget out of wedlock. [R.] --Shak.
From WordNet (r) 1.7 (wn)
bastardize
v 1: change something so that its value declines; for example,
art forms [syn: {bastardise}]
2: declare a child to be illegitimate [syn: {bastardise}]
